#d4e2fe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d4e2fe is composed of 83.1% red, 88.6% green and 99.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 16.5% cyan, 11% magenta, 0% yellow and 0.4% black. It has a hue angle of 220 degrees, a saturation of 95.5% and a lightness of 91.4%. #d4e2fe color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a9c5fd. Closest websafe color is: #ccccff.

Shades and Tints of #d4e2fe

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#00050f is the darkest color, while #fafcff is the lightest one.
